jobs description

Location: Nottingham

Salary: Competitive daily rates

Job Type: Flexible, Part-time, Full-time

We are seeking an enthusiastic and passionate History Teacher to join our vibrant team. If you have a love for history and a commitment to inspiring students to explore the past, we want to hear from you! This is a fantastic opportunity to contribute to the academic development of students in a dynamic educational environment.

Key Responsibilities:

* Teach History to KS3, KS4, and possibly KS5 students, following the national curriculum.

* Deliver engaging and interactive history lessons that make the subject accessible and exciting for students of all abilities.

* Support students in their academic progress, providing constructive feedback and tailored guidance.

* Prepare students for GCSE History exams and other relevant assessments.

* Encourage critical thinking, historical inquiry, and the development of analytical skills.

* Promote an understanding of global history, including British and world history, through diverse teaching methods.

* Work collaboratively with other teachers and staff to ensure the success of the History department.

* Contribute to extracurricular activities and school events that promote a deeper understanding of history.

Requirements:

*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ent.

* A degree in History, History Education, or a related field.

* Proven experience teaching History at secondary school level (preferably KS3 and KS4).

* Strong understanding of the GCSE History curriculum and exam specifications.

* A passion for history and an ability to inspire students with diverse learning styles.

* Excellent classroom management and organizational skills.

* Strong communication skills, both written and verbal.

Desirable:

* Experience teaching A-Level History or other advanced qualifications.

* Specialisms in modern history, world history, or a specific historical period.

* Involvement in history clubs or educational trips related to history.

* Familiarity with the latest teaching methods and educational technologies to enhance learning.
